Question 734000: Convert the numeral to a numeral in base 10.
1101 two.
Thank you!

Answer by josgarithmetic(39616)   (Show Source): You can put this solution on YOUR website!
The base two position places count these:
[eight] [four] [two] [one]
Your number to convert is as base-two,
[ 1 ] [ 1 ] [ 0 ] [ 1 ]

The meaning is
[ 8 ] + [ 4 ] + [ 0 ] + [ 1 ]
=13.
